It's been almost two years since the BMG-G31 silicon first showed up in the rumor mill, pointing toward a highly capable Battlemage GPU that could solidify Intel's position among the best graphics cards. While the company's gaming ambitions have significantly slowed down since then, the BMG-G31 now powers the new Arc Pro B70 workstation GPU, which has just been tested by Expreview with a solid showing in games.
Across five titles at 1440p resolution, the B70 was about 32.5% faster on average than the Arc B580, but about 6.8% slower than the RTX 5060 Ti 16GB. While it lost against the Green Team in the other four games, the B70 actually saw 14% higher FPS in Cyberpunk 2077 (which generally favors Nvidia GPUs), netting 90 FPS against the 5060 Ti's 68 FPS.
Swipe to scroll horizontally 1440p Raster Performance - FPS Game Arc Pro B70 32GB RTX 5060 Ti 16GB Arc B580 12GB Cyberpunk 2077 90.27 79.06 66.02 Monster Hunter Wilds 51.33 56.53 39.23 Marvel Rivals 69.00 74.00 49.00 Assassin's Creed Shadows 49.00 58.00 42.00 Black Myth: Wukong 44.00 53.00 32.00
Switching to ray tracing performance, the Arc Pro B70 expectedly looks a lot better, pushing 1% more frames than the RTX 5060 Ti on average, beating it in three of the five titles. Against the Arc B580, the workstation offering is about 40% faster. F1 2025 sees the biggest win for the B70 where it gets 14% more FPS compared to the 5060 Ti. Across all games in both raster and RT, however, the RTX 5060 Ti 16GB is still 2.9% ahead of the B70 — that's mighty close for a GPU not even meant for gaming.

As a reminder, the Arc Pro B70 is Intel's top-end Battlemage offering at the moment, while the Arc B580 remains its flagship gaming-focused GPU. The B70 features a whopping 32GB of (ECC) GDDR6 VRAM, so it has an inherent advantage over pretty much any gaming GPU. There's a software disadvantage, however, with the Arc Pro B70 using Intel's Pro driver as opposed to its gaming-focused Arc driver.
As such, in MLPerf Client, the Arc Pro B70 had a token throughput of 95.5 tokens per second, compared to just 73.7 tok/s on the RTX 5060 Ti. When it comes to TTFT (time to first token), the B70 absolutely annihilated the Nvidia GPU by being more than 4 times as fast thanks to its bigger memory pool. The Arc Pro B580, which has only 12GB of VRAM, was also about 64.52% faster here compared to the 5060 Ti.
